L'intelligence artificielle (IA) est un domaine fascinant de la science et de la technologie qui propose des solutions open source innovantes à des problèmes complexes. Elle évolue rapidement et se manifeste dans de nombreux secteurs de notre vie quotidienne. Cet article vise à explorer les fondamentaux, les technologies, les applications et les défis qui entourent l'intelligence artificielle.

Comprendre les bases de l'intelligence artificielle
Pour appréhender l'intelligence artificielle, il est essentiel de commencer par en comprendre les bases. Cela inclut une définition précise de ce qu'est l'IA ainsi que les concepts clés qui la sous-tendent. En outre, un aperçu de son histoire et de son évolution montre à quel point ce domaine a progressé au fil des décennies.
Définition et concepts clés
L'intelligence artificielle se réfère à la capacité d'une machine à réaliser des tâches qui, normalement, nécessiteraient une intelligence humaine. Cela inclut des capacités comme la compréhension du langage, la perception visuelle, et même des compétences de prise de décision. Les concepts clés incluent l'apprentissage automatique, l'apprentissage profond, et les systèmes de recommandation, qui sont tous des aspects fondamentaux de l'IA moderne.
Un autre aspect important est la distinction entre l'IA faible et l'IA forte. L'IA faible se concentre sur des tâches spécifiques, tandis que l'IA forte, qui est encore largement théorique, vise à reproduire les facultés humaines dans leur ensemble.
Histoire et évolution de l'IA
L'histoire de l'intelligence artificielle remonte aux années 1950, lorsque les premiers chercheurs ont commencé à explorer la possibilité de créer des machines capables de penser. Au fil des ans, divers mouvements ont influencé le développement open source de l'IA, des systèmes experts aux réseaux de neurones. Les années 1990 et 2000 ont vu une résurgence d'intérêt pour l'IA, alimentée par des avancées dans la puissance de calcul et l'accès à de grandes quantités de données open source.
Plus récemment, l'IA a connu une explosion d'applications grâce aux progrès en apprentissage automatique et en traitement du langage naturel, rendant beaucoup de choses possibles, de la reconnaissance vocale aux chatbots, en passant par la vision par ordinateur.
En France, l'IA est également au cœur de nombreux débats concernant l'éthique et la régulation. Les chercheurs et les décideurs s'interrogent sur les implications morales de l'utilisation de l'IA, notamment en ce qui concerne la vie privée et la sécurité informatique. Des initiatives sont mises en place pour garantir que l'IA soit développée de manière responsable, en tenant compte des valeurs humaines et des droits fondamentaux. Par exemple, le gouvernement français a lancé des programmes pour encourager l'innovation tout en veillant à ce que les technologies respectent les normes éthiques.
De plus, la collaboration entre les secteurs public et privé est essentielle pour faire avancer la recherche en IA. Les universités et les entreprises travaillent ensemble pour développer des solutions open source qui peuvent bénéficier à la société dans son ensemble. Cette synergie permet non seulement de faire progresser la technologie, mais aussi d'assurer que les résultats de l'IA soient accessibles et bénéfiques pour tous, renforçant ainsi l'idée que l'intelligence artificielle peut être un outil puissant pour le progrès social.
Les technologies sous-jacentes
Au fond, l'intelligence artificielle repose sur plusieurs technologies complexes qui lui permettent de traiter les informations et d'apprendre de nouvelles compétences. Examinons trois des technologies les plus importantes qui soutiennent l'IA moderne : l'apprentissage automatique, les réseaux de neurones artificiels et le traitement du langage naturel.
Apprentissage automatique
L'apprentissage automatique (machine learning) est une sous-discipline de l'IA qui donne aux ordinateurs la capacité d'apprendre sans être explicitement programmés. En utilisant des algorithmes, les machines peuvent analyser des données, reconnaître des motifs et prendre des décisions basées sur des expériences antérieures. Cette technologie est essentielle pour le développement de systèmes intelligents.
Il existe différentes approches de l'apprentissage automatique, y compris l'apprentissage supervisé, non supervisé et semi-supervisé. Chacune de ces méthodes a ses propres applications et est choisie en fonction des besoins spécifiques du projet open source. Par exemple, l'apprentissage supervisé est souvent utilisé dans des domaines tels que la reconnaissance d'image, où des étiquettes sont fournies pour entraîner le modèle, tandis que l'apprentissage non supervisé peut être appliqué à des ensembles de données sans étiquettes pour découvrir des structures cachées.
Réseaux de neurones artificiels
Les réseaux de neurones artificiels s'inspirent du fonctionnement du cerveau humain pour traiter les informations. Ils sont composés de couches de nœuds (neurones) qui se connectent et communiquent entre eux. Cette architecture permet aux machines d'effectuer des prévisions complexes et de reconnaître des modèles dans des données bruyantes.
Les réseaux de neurones, en particulier les réseaux de neurones profonds (deep learning), ont largement contribué à des avancées remarquables dans des domaines tels que la vision par ordinateur et la traduction automatique, démontrant une efficacité sans précédent dans le traitement des données. De plus, ces réseaux sont capables de traiter des volumes massifs de données, ce qui les rend indispensables dans des applications comme la reconnaissance vocale et l'analyse d'image, où la précision et la rapidité sont cruciales.
Traitement du langage naturel
Le traitement du langage naturel (NLP) est une branche de l'IA qui permet aux ordinateurs de comprendre et d'interagir avec le langage humain. Cela inclut des tâches comme la traduction de langues, l'analyse des sentiments et la génération de texte. Grâce à des modèles avancés, les machines peuvent désormais comprendre le contexte, les nuances et même l'humour dans une conversation.
Le NLP a transformé la façon dont les entreprises interagissent avec les clients, rendant les chatbots et les assistants virtuels de plus en plus populaires. Ces technologies facilitent la communication, rendant l'information plus accessible. En outre, le traitement du langage naturel joue un rôle essentiel dans l'analyse des données textuelles, permettant aux entreprises d'extraire des insights précieux à partir de commentaires clients, de publications sur les réseaux sociaux et d'autres sources de données textuelles. Cela ouvre de nouvelles perspectives pour le marketing, la recherche et le développement de produits, en offrant une compréhension plus profonde des préférences et des besoins des consommateurs.
Applications de l'intelligence artificielle
Les applications de l'intelligence artificielle sont vastes et variées, touchant à de nombreux secteurs et domaines. De la santé aux transports, en passant par le secteur financier, l'IA transforme les industries et améliore l'efficacité ainsi que l'expérience client.
IA dans la santé
Dans le secteur de la santé, l'IA joue un rôle crucial dans le diagnostic précoce des maladies, l'analyse des images médicales et le développement de traitements personnalisés. Grâce à des algorithmes d'apprentissage automatique, les professionnels de la santé peuvent détecter des anomalies dans les scans, prédire des résultats de traitement et même gérer les soins aux patients de manière plus proactive.
Les services de médecine personnalisée sont également en pleine expansion, rendant l'utilisation de l'IA pour adapter les traitements en fonction des gens de plus en plus courante.
IA dans les transports
Dans le secteur des transports, l'IA est à la base des technologies de conduite autonome et des systèmes de navigation intelligents. Ces systèmes utilisent des capteurs, des caméras et des algorithmes avancés pour interpréter l'environnement en temps réel, garantissant une navigation sûre et efficace.
Les applications vont au-delà des véhicules autonomes, avec des systèmes optimisés pour la gestion du trafic urbain et la maintenance prédictive des infrastructures de transport, rendant nos villes plus intelligentes et plus agréables à vivre.
IA dans le secteur financier
Dans le domaine financier, l'intelligence artificielle est utilisée pour détecter des fraudes, évaluer des risques et automatiser des transactions. Les algorithmes d'apprentissage automatique peuvent analyser des flux de données massive pour identifier des comportements suspects, préparant ainsi les institutions financières à répondre rapidement à des menaces potentielles.
De plus, l'IA permet la personnalisation des services financiers, offrant des recommandations et conseils adaptés aux besoins uniques des clients. Cela améliore la prise de décision et accroît la satisfaction des clients.
Défis et considérations éthiques
Malgré ses nombreux avantages, l'intelligence artificielle pose également des défis majeurs et soulève des considérations éthiques qu'il est crucial de prendre en compte. De la lutte contre les biais à la gestion de la confidentialité des données, ces questions sont fondamentales pour façonner l'avenir de l'IA.
Biais et discrimination
L'un des défis les plus préoccupants de l'IA est le biais inhérent à ses algorithmes. Si les données utilisées pour former ces modèles contiennent des préjugés ou des inégalités, cela peut aboutir à des résultats discriminatoires. Il est essentiel d'identifier et de minimiser ces biais pour garantir que l'IA soit équitable et bénéfique pour tous.
Les entreprises et les chercheurs doivent donc travailler ensemble pour développer des normes et des protocoles garantissant l'équité et la transparence dans les systèmes d'IA.
Confidentialité des données
La gestion de la confidentialité des données est également un enjeu majeur. L'IA nécessite des volumes considérables de données pour apprendre et s'améliorer, ce qui peut soulever des inquiétudes quant à la collecte et à l'utilisation de données sensibles. Il est vital de mettre en place des politiques robustes pour protéger la vie privée des utilisateurs et garantir que leurs données soient utilisées de manière éthique.
Les réglementations comme le RGPD en Europe sont un pas dans la bonne direction, mais les entreprises doivent aller plus loin pour établir une relation de confiance avec leurs clients.
Impact sur l'emploi
Enfin, l'impact de l'IA sur l'emploi soulève des questions cruciales. Si l'automatisation peut améliorer l'efficacité, elle peut également entraîner la disparition de certains postes. Les travailleurs doivent donc être préparés à s'adapter à un marché du travail en constante évolution et acquérir de nouvelles compétences pour rester pertinents.
Les gouvernements et les entreprises ont un rôle clé à jouer pour favoriser cette transition, en investissant dans des programmes de formation et d'éducation pour aider les travailleurs à s'ajuster aux exigences futures du marché.
En somme, l'intelligence artificielle offre d'innombrables possibilités, mais elle vient également avec des responsabilités éthiques. L'avenir de l'IA dépendra de notre capacité à en tirer parti tout en surmontant les défis associés.
En conclusion, l'intelligence artificielle, avec ses logiciels libres et ses licences libres, est en train de révolutionner divers secteurs. Des logiciels pour entreprises aux plateformes logiciels libres, l'IA open source offre des solutions innovantes et accessibles. Les développeurs et les DevOps jouent un rôle crucial dans le développement open source de ces technologies, en s'appuyant sur des communautés open source dynamiques.
Les logiciels open source tels que les chat open source, les messageries open source, les emails open source, et les serveurs de messagerie sont de plus en plus populaires. Les entreprises open source adoptent des solutions open source pour améliorer la sécurité informatique et offrir un support logiciels libres de qualité.
Les plateformes open source comme le drive open source et le cloud open source permettent aux utilisateurs de stocker et de partager des données open source en toute sécurité. Les programmes open source et les services open source offrent une alternative viable aux solutions propriétaires, en promouvant la transparence et la collaboration.
En fin de compte, l'IA open source représente une troisième voie numérique (3eme voie numérique) qui combine innovation et responsabilité éthique, ouvrant la voie à un avenir technologique plus inclusif et durable.